[1] : The Collaborative International Dictionary of English v.0.48
cheap-jack \cheap"-jack`\, cheap-john \cheap"-john`\, n.
   a seller of low-priced, shoddy, or second goods; a hawker.

   syn: huckster, hawker, tout.
        1913 webster

[3] : WordNet (r) 2.0
cheapjack
     adj : cheap and shoddy; "cheapjack moviemaking...that feeds on the
           low taste of the mob"- judith crist syn: shoddy, tawdry
